Key Players in the Seedling Trays Market

The seedling trays market is a competitive market, with several key players dominating the landscape. Companies such as A.M.A. Horticulture Inc., TO Plastics, Stuewe & Sons, and Landmark Plastics are among the top contenders in the sector. These market giants have established themselves as leaders in seedling tray manufacturing, offering a wide range of products to cater to the diverse needs of customers worldwide.

In addition, emerging players such as Kord Products Inc. and East Jordan Plastics are making significant strides in the seedling trays market, challenging the market incumbents with their innovative approaches and cutting-edge technologies. These up-and-coming companies are disrupting the traditional market dynamics and driving the market towards greater innovation and sustainability.

Factors Influencing the Demand for Seedling Trays

Factors influencing the demand for seedling trays are diverse and multifaceted. The growing trend towards sustainable agriculture practices has significantly boosted the demand for seedling trays made from eco-friendly materials. Consumers are increasingly prioritizing products that align with their environmental values, leading to a surge in the adoption of biodegradable and recyclable seedling trays. Additionally, the emphasis on reducing plastic waste and promoting responsible production methods has propelled the demand for seedling trays manufactured from alternative materials such as rice husks, coconut coir, and biodegradable plastics.

Moreover, the rising interest in home gardening and urban farming has also contributed to the increased demand for seedling trays. As more individuals embrace gardening as a hobby or a means of self-sufficiency, the need for high-quality seedling trays for starting plants indoors has grown. The convenience and efficiency offered by seedling trays in initiating the germination process and fostering healthy plant growth have made them essential tools for gardening enthusiasts of all levels. This trend is expected to continue driving the demand for seedling trays in both residential and commercial gardening applications.
